County of San Diego – Solid Waste System Divestiture – A Nossaman attorney advised the County in its $180 million divestiture of its solid waste system and assets, the largest municipal divestiture of solid waste assets in the United States. The transaction included the sale of 4 landfills, 1 transfer station, 1 recycling center and other solid waste assets to Allied Waste. A Nossaman attorney structured and implemented the County's procurement process and also served as lead drafter and negotiator for the County on all aspects of the transaction and coordinated all due diligence and closed the multi-property escrow as scheduled. The sale of the assets was the first successful privatization of publicly owned landfill assets in recent years in California.
